Mahudi Population - Banaskantha, Gujarat
Mahudi is a medium size village located in Danta Taluka of Banaskantha district, Gujarat with total 116 families residing. The Mahudi village has population of 624 of which 320 are males while 304 are females as per Population Census 2011.In Mahudi village population of children with age 0-6 is 152 which makes up 24.36 % of total population of village. Average Sex Ratio of Mahudi village is 950 which is higher than Gujarat state average of 919. Child Sex Ratio for the Mahudi as per census is 854, lower than Gujarat average of 890.
Mahudi village has lower literacy rate compared to Gujarat. In 2011, literacy rate of Mahudi village was 68.01 % compared to 78.03 % of Gujarat. In Mahudi Male literacy stands at 81.93 % while female literacy rate was 53.85 %.
